Overview

The V350 is a four-channel VME-module analog/digital function generator that generates arbitrary waveshapes synchronized with logic-level outputs, as might be used in control systems or radar simulation, or other COTS applications.

Each V350 channel generates one 12-bit analog waveform and up to four digital outputs by scanning sequential data points stored in user-loadable memory. Outputs are processed by digital-to-analog converters, smoothing filters, and output amplifiers.
Output stage multiplexing allows flexible configuration, and channels may operate independently or may be synchronized within a module or across modules.

Image:V350DSWEBpix.jpg

Control and waveform generation operate at full 40-MHz rate or programmed sub-multiples. An option allows waveform generation synchronous to an external trigger without the jitter resulting from quantization to the local clock.

Each channel has 1 Mword of waveform memory controlled through a 512-block command table that includes Play, Delay, Wait, and Stop commands, conditional jump, and flag control.

Self-test and Demo modes allow quick evaluation and verification.

Specifications


MODEL V350 VME FUNCTION GENERATOR MODULE
FUNCTION
4-channel 40 Ms/s analog/digital waveform synthesis VME module.
CONFORMANCE
Conforms with ANSI/IEEE 1014 VMEbus spec; supports 16-bit data transfers. Does not support byte writes.
PACKAGING
Single-wide 6U Eurocard.
DEVICE TYPE
16-bit VME register-based slave: A24:A16:D16; implements 128 16-bit registers at switch-selectable addresses in the VME 16- or 24-bit addressing spaces.
OUTPUTS

Four arbitrary waveform outputs, 0:10 volts max, 50-ohm output impedance, 100 mA max; analog bandwidth 1 MHz full power min.

Bipolar outputs available.

Four TTL-level pulse outputs

TTL-level waveform sync and pulse sync outputs

INPUTS

One 10 MHz clock input/output

Four TTL-level logic inputs

WAVE MEMORY
1M x 16 bits per channel (12 DAC bits, four digital bits)
CONNECTORS

SMA female connectors for waveform outputs, pulse outputs, clock. Other connectors optional.

DB-9 female for two sync outputs and four logic inputs

INDICATORS

LEDs indicate processor heartbeat and VME access.
POWER
Standard VME supplies:

+5 volts, 1.75A max

+12 volts, 200 mA max (plus load current)

-12 volts, 100 mA max
